The Flying RuNR podcast, by the Marathon Mates, is your journey through running, friendship, & adventure. Hosted by Tim, Tara, Tony & Lucia, four Six-Star Medalists, the show captures the thrill of running & the friendships it creates. From race recaps & inspiring athlete interviews to personal stories, it’s all about the bonds formed on the road. Whether you're a newbie or pro, enjoy training tips, race-day advice, and the motivation to keep going. Plus, get travel and prep tips from their six-star marathon journeys.
